Title:
SPATIAL COHERENCE STRUCTURE REGULATION-BASED OPTICAL IMAGING SYSTEM AND IMAGING METHOD

Abstract:
A spatial coherence structure regulation-based optical imaging method, comprising the following steps: constructing a 4f imaging system; detecting the shape of a spectral domain obstacle (11) in the 4f imaging system by means of a first photodetector (16); designing a spatial coherence structure of an incident light beam according to the shape of the spectral domain obstacle (11) in the 4f imaging system, so that all modes of the incident light beam may pass through an opening of the obstacle (11); and placing an object to be measured (19) in an optical path, and detecting optical imaging information of the object (19) by means of a second photodetector (20). When the frequency plane of the 4f optical imaging system is partially blocked, imaging may be achieved without speckles, and the utilization rate of system light may be greatly improved while improving the signal-to-noise ratio of the imaging. Also disclosed is a spatial coherence structure regulation-based optical imaging system.
